发明名称 PROTON CONDUCTIVE SILICA
摘要 <P>PROBLEM TO BE SOLVED: To solve the problem that a conventional proton conductor formed from a polymer material is not stably operated at a high temperature in the case when the conventional proton conductor is used as an electrolyte in a fuel cell because the conventional proton conductor is insufficient in heat resistance, chemical stability and dimensional stability and hardly operates stably as a proton conductor at a temperature higher than 100&deg;C. <P>SOLUTION: Proton conductive silica at least has an anionic group represented by formula (1), and has proton conductivity of &ge;0.1 S/cm under conditions that the temperature is 150&deg;C and the relative humidity is 100%. In the formula (1), X is a substituent selected from C<SB>m</SB>H<SB>2m</SB>(m=1-10), C<SB>m</SB>F<SB>2m</SB>(m=1-10), C<SB>m</SB>Cl<SB>2m</SB>(m=1-10), C<SB>m</SB>Br<SB>2m</SB>(m=1-10), phenyl group, benzyl group, naphthyl group, and anthryl group. <P>COPYRIGHT: (C)2010,JPO&INPIT
